About the event

The Yellow-Legged Hornet is rapidly becoming a serious concern for beekeepers. With its aggressive hunting behavior and ability to devastate hives, understanding this invasive threat is critical for protecting our bees.

Join Shirley Harris for an informative and timely presentation covering:

  • How to identify the Yellow-Legged Hornet

  • Its lifecycle and hunting behavior

  • The potential impact on honey bee colonies

  • Monitoring and reporting recommendations
